UniProt Comments
Function: Catalyzes the synthesis of mevalonate. The specific precursor of all isoprenoid compounds present in plants.Catalytic activity: (R)-mevalonate + CoA + 2 NADP+ = (S)-3-hydroxy-3-methylglutaryl-CoA + 2 NADPH.Pathway: Metabolic intermediate biosynthesis; (R)-mevalonate biosynthesis; (R)-mevalonate from acetyl-CoA: step 3/3.Subcellular location: Endoplasmic reticulum membrane; Multi-pass membrane protein. Sequence similarities: Belongs to the HMG-CoA reductase family.
